Is there a way, using facebook API, to retrieve any historical data about user?

Posted by litwol on September 23, 2011 at 4:45pm

I am looking for a way to retrieve historical data about users using facebook api. such things as which posts user liked in the past, which events user RSVP'd in the past, perhaps even friendship statuses from the past. Have you guys come across something similar? I've spent considerable amount of time yesterday learning facebook graph api as thoroughly as i could and was not able to find any such data. more so, i find that taking all data available via facebook api it will not be possible to reconstruct any historical data.

Facebook Live Stream Module for Drupal Released

Posted by pflame on May 29, 2009 at 6:14am

We've just released Facebook Live Stream module. This module leverages the Facebook Open Stream API. Once installed, the module allows users of the Drupal instance to access their Facebook account and view the real time stream of their friends’ updates from Facebook in a block within their Drupal instance.
